ORDER

The prayer in the writ petition is for a Writ of Mandamus to direct the respondent herein to issue a separate patta to the petitioner for his lands to an extent of 1.40.5 Hectares in S.No.604 of Theppampatti Village, Aandipatti Taluk, Theni District by considering his representation dated 28.03.2019. 2.The petitioner, in order to get patta for his land at S.No.604 of Theppampatti Village, had made a request to the respondent Tahsildar on 28.03.2019. In this regard, the learned counsel for the petitioner would submit that the petitioner has paid Kist for the said land and the Village Administrative Officer concerned has given a certificate to that effect pertaining to the possession of the said land. Based on these documents, when the petitioner made request to the respondent Tahsildar, the same has not so far been considered. Therefore, the petitioner is before this Court.

3. Heard the learned Government Advocate, who would submit that the said representation of the petitioner for grant of patta would be considered after conducting due enquiry, of course, with the petitioner as well as other stake holders, and a final decision would be taken by the Tahsildar concerned within a time framed to be stipulated by this Court.

4. Considering the said submission made by either side, this Court is inclined to pass the following direction: "that the respondent Tahsildar is directed to consider the request of the petitioner dated 28.03.2019 and take a decision thereon by conducting an enquiry with the petitioner and the other stake holders/private parties and pass orders thereon in respect of the grievance of the petitioner, on merits and in accordance with law, within a period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order."

5. With the above direction, this writ petition is disposed of. No costs.
